Understanding Task Analysis: A Tool for Skill Development
Task analysis is a powerful method used in various fields to break down complex tasks into smaller, manageable steps. This approach is incredibly effective in teaching, particularly for students with special needs, as it helps simplify challenging skills into parts that are easier to understand and execute. By focusing on individual components, task analysis provides a structured framework that supports learning, motivation, and skill acquisition.
Task analysis is a systematic approach to breaking down complex tasks into smaller, manageable subtasks. By documenting each step sequentially, it becomes easier to identify and address the difficulties faced by individuals, particularly those on the autism spectrum. This method not only aids in understanding the physical actions required but also sheds light on the cognitive processes involved in completing these tasks.
There are two main types of task analysis that are commonly used:
Cognitive Task Analysis (CTA): This focuses on the mental processes involved in performing a task. It helps in understanding how users think, make decisions, and solve problems while managing a specific activity.CTA is vital for designing training programs that cater to cognitive skills.
Hierarchical Task Analysis (HTA): This type provides a structured representation of the various components involved in a task. It breaks tasks down into a hierarchy that visually represents each subtask's relationship and sequence, aiding in clearer instructional design.
By employing these methods, especially in educational settings, task analysis supports the creation of teaching strategies that are aligned with individual learner needs. This leads to more effective skill acquisition and higher performance levels.
An effective task analysis ensures that both physical and cognitive aspects are integrated into the instruction, thereby enhancing understanding and success in skill execution.

Task analysis (TA) is a vital tool in educational settings, especially for students with special needs. It involves breaking down complex tasks into smaller, manageable steps which facilitates effective learning. By focusing on observable behaviors and clearly outlining each action, TA helps students, particularly those with executive functioning challenges, acquire essential skills like hygiene routines and social interactions.
For instance, teaching a student how to brush their teeth can encompass an 11-step process, detailing each action from wetting the toothbrush to spitting out the toothpaste. This level of detail helps to ensure comprehension and mastery.
Educators can customize the task analysis to meet individual student needs by evaluating their skill levels, age, and prior experiences. This personalization ensures that teaching is both appropriate and effective. It allows teachers to set clear goals based on students' abilities, ensuring that every step is aligned with the learner's pace and capabilities.
Techniques like forward chaining and backward chaining further enhance the learning process. In forward chaining, students begin with the first step and progressively learn subsequent steps. Conversely, backward chaining starts with the final step, providing immediate reinforcement for completion. Both methods encourage independence and boost the learner's confidence.
Task analysis is not limited to hygiene practices; it also effectively supports students in various academic tasks. For example, breaking down reading comprehension into steps, such as identifying unfamiliar words and summarizing text, can enhance understanding.
